7061 Rockville Road in Indianapolis, IN was first built in 1955 and is 69 years old.
This has been categorized as a residential property type.
It is a single story home.
There are a total of 6 rooms in the home, of which, 3 are bedrooms.
7061 Rockville Road has 960 sqft of living area. This is typically the area of a building that is heated or air conditioned and does not include the garage, porch or basement square footage.
The linear feet across the front of the lot is 1,500 ft and the linear feet between the front and back of the lot is 760.
In total, the area measurement of the land is 12,502 square feet.
